-- GWMONTR MIB -- Novell GroupWise Monitor Information Base (MIB) -- Copyright (C) 1994, 1995, 1997, 1999 Novell Inc., All Rights Reserved -- Naming Tree: 1.3.6.1.4.1.23 -- iso(1) org(3) dod(6) internet(1) private(4) enterprises(1) novell(23) -- Date: May 3, 1999 GWMONITOR-MIB DEFINITIONS ::= BEGIN IMPORTS Counter, TimeTicks, Gauge, enterprises FROM RFC1155-SMI DisplayString FROM RFC1213-MIB TRAP-TYPE FROM RFC-1215 OBJECT-TYPE FROM RFC-1212; novell OBJECT IDENTIFIER ::= { enterprises 23 } mibDoc OBJECT IDENTIFIER ::= { novell 2 } gwmontr OBJECT IDENTIFIER ::= { mibDoc 40 } gwmonserver OBJECT IDENTIFIER ::= { gwmontr 5 } gwmonTrapInfo OBJECT IDENTIFIER ::= { gwmonserver 1 } gwmonTraps OBJECT IDENTIFIER ::= { gwmonserver 2 } -- ================================================== gwmonTrapInfo ========= -- The gwmonTrapInfo group -- These objects are used only in traps produced by GroupWise Monitor gwmonTrapTime OBJECT-TYPE SYNTAX INTEGER ACCESS not-accessible STATUS mandatory DESCRIPTION "The time the trap occurred. Seconds since Jan 1, 1970 (GMT)" ::= { gwmonTrapInfo 1 } gwmonAgentName OBJECT-TYPE SYNTAX DisplayString (SIZE (0..255)) ACCESS not-accessible STATUS mandatory DESCRIPTION "Affected agent's name." ::= { gwmonTrapInfo 2 } gwmonAgentType OBJECT-TYPE SYNTAX DisplayString (SIZE (0..255)) ACCESS not-accessible STATUS mandatory DESCRIPTION "Affected agent's type." ::= { gwmonTrapInfo 3 } gwmonStatus OBJECT-TYPE SYNTAX DisplayString (SIZE (0..255)) ACCESS not-accessible STATUS mandatory DESCRIPTION "Status of the affected agent." ::= { gwmonTrapInfo 4 } gwmonStatusDuration OBJECT-TYPE SYNTAX TimeTicks ACCESS not-accessible STATUS mandatory DESCRIPTION "Duration of affected agent's current status." ::= { gwmonTrapInfo 5 } gwmonThreshold OBJECT-TYPE SYNTAX DisplayString (SIZE (0..255)) ACCESS not-accessible STATUS mandatory DESCRIPTION "The threshold expression that has failed." ::= { gwmonTrapInfo 6 } gwmonThresholdValues OBJECT-TYPE SYNTAX DisplayString (SIZE (0..255)) ACCESS not-accessible STATUS mandatory DESCRIPTION "The values used to determine the failure. For a threshold failure, these will be the threshold values at the time the threshold was evaluated." ::= { gwmonTrapInfo 7 } gwmonThresholdSeverity OBJECT-TYPE SYNTAX DisplayString (SIZE (0..255)) ACCESS not-accessible STATUS mandatory DESCRIPTION "The severity of the exceeded threshold. It will be one of the following values: Unknown, Normal, Informational, Marginal, Warning, Minor, Major, Critical" ::= { gwmonTrapInfo 8 } gwmonServerName OBJECT-TYPE SYNTAX DisplayString (SIZE (0..255)) ACCESS not-accessible STATUS mandatory DESCRIPTION "Affected agent's server name." ::= { gwmonTrapInfo 9 } gwmonServerIPAddress OBJECT-TYPE SYNTAX DisplayString (SIZE (0..255)) ACCESS not-accessible STATUS mandatory DESCRIPTION "Affected agent's server IP Address." ::= { gwmonTrapInfo 10 } -- ====================================== GroupWise Monitor Traps ========= gwmonThresholdExceededTrap TRAP-TYPE ENTERPRISE gwmonTraps VARIABLES {gwmonTrapTime, gwmonAgentType, gwmonAgentName, gwmonServerName, gwmonServerIPAddress, gwmonThresholdValues, gwmonThresholdSeverity } DESCRIPTION "GroupWise Monitor detects a threshold has been exceeded" --ManageWise Trap annotation --#TYPE "GroupWise threshold exceeded." --#SUMMARY "GroupWise Monitor detects a threshold has been exceeded for %s. Threshold: [%s]" --#ARGUMENTS { 3,6 } --#SEVERITY MAJOR --#TIMEINDEX 0 --#STATE DEGRADED ::= 1 gwmonThresholdRecoveredTrap TRAP-TYPE ENTERPRISE gwmonTraps VARIABLES {gwmonTrapTime, gwmonAgentType, gwmonAgentName, gwmonServerName, gwmonServerIPAddress } --ManageWise Trap annotation --#TYPE "GroupWise threshold recovered." --#SUMMARY "GroupWise Monitor detects a threshold has recovered for %s." --#ARGUMENTS { 3 } --#SEVERITY INFORMATIONAL --#TIMEINDEX 0 --#STATE OPERATIONAL ::= 2 gwmonAgentDownTrap TRAP-TYPE ENTERPRISE gwmonTraps VARIABLES {gwmonTrapTime, gwmonAgentType, gwmonAgentName, gwmonServerName, gwmonServerIPAddress } --ManageWise Trap annotation --#TYPE "GroupWise agent down." --#SUMMARY "GroupWise Monitor detects the agent running for %s is down." --#ARGUMENTS { 3 } --#SEVERITY CRITICAL --#TIMEINDEX 0 --#STATE NONOPERATIONAL ::= 3 gwmonAgentUpTrap TRAP-TYPE ENTERPRISE gwmonTraps VARIABLES {gwmonTrapTime, gwmonAgentType, gwmonAgentName, gwmonServerName, gwmonServerIPAddress } --ManageWise Trap annotation --#TYPE "GroupWise agent up." --#SUMMARY "GroupWise Monitor detects the agent running for %s is up." --#ARGUMENTS { 3 } --#SEVERITY INFORMATIONAL --#TIMEINDEX 0 --#STATE OPERATIONAL ::= 4 gwmonTestTrap TRAP-TYPE ENTERPRISE gwmonTraps VARIABLES {gwmonTrapTime } --ManageWise Trap annotation --#TYPE "GroupWise Monitor trap test." --#SUMMARY "GroupWise Monitor trap test." --#ARGUMENTS { } --#SEVERITY INFORMATIONAL --#TIMEINDEX 0 --#STATE OPERATIONAL ::= 5 gwmonPeriodicTrap TRAP-TYPE ENTERPRISE gwmonTraps VARIABLES {gwmonTrapTime } --ManageWise Trap annotation --#TYPE "GroupWise Monitor periodic trap." --#SUMMARY "GroupWise Monitor periodic trap." --#ARGUMENTS { } --#SEVERITY INFORMATIONAL --#TIMEINDEX 0 --#STATE OPERATIONAL ::= 6 END